Use the following expressions in your own sentences:
- We all agree that
- It is he/she who
- Don’t you see
- None of us

उत्तर
- We all agree that: We all agree that the picnic has to be cancelled.
- It is he/she who: It is she who broke the window.
- Don't you see: Don't you see that we need to plant many, many trees?
- None of us: None of us had the least idea that she was unhappy.
